Therapists need therapists.
And CEOs? We need people like .assistant .
Samantha (.assistant ) and I were sitting on the couch having a chat about how so many therapists, especially new ones, underestimate the importance of having their own therapist.
And, it’s wild, because when I mentioned in a recent talk that I have one, the whole room went quiet. Like… wait, you still see a therapist?
Yes. I do.
Because the more you pour into others, the more you realize how much you need safe spaces to pour back into you.
The same goes for business.
Having someone like my operations manager, Samantha, in my corner has changed everything.
She helps me zoom out when I’m too close to the details, points out blind spots I didn’t even know I had, and reminds me that I don’t have to do it all…or do it perfectly…or do it alone.
That’s the beauty of support, both emotional and operational.
My therapist helps me process what’s in me.
Samantha helps me manage all the business things around me.
And my hubby and trusted family/friends help me manage everything else.
And together, they help me show up as the best version of me…as a leader, a therapist, a wife, mom, friend and a human being.
Because help isn’t a weakness. It’s wisdom.
You can’t pour into clients from an empty cup…and you shouldn’t have to.
